Public-private cooperation and the processing of sensitive data were key to the success of a high-risk intervention by Iris Global

Against the vast and challenging backdrop of the international waters, health emergencies may suddenly and unexpectedly arise. This was the case in a recent event that took place off the Spanish coast, where a vessel on the high seas became the setting of an emergency medical operation that required a rapid and coordinated approach. This incident highlights the importance of cooperation between different factors in critical situations, proving how Iris Global’s extensive international assistance network was able to save a person’s limb and, possibly, their life.

The story began when a member of the vessel’s crew suffered a traumatic amputation of their right hand while at sea. Such was the seriousness of the situation that an immediate evacuation and transfer to a hospital was required in order to perform a surgical reattachment.

However, the distance, the remote location of the vessel, and the need to manage the situation confidentially for safety reasons due to the patient’s professional activity, posed a challenge. The complexity of the operation required flawless coordination between various entities, from the 112 emergency number service to the maritime rescue team and the surgical team.

Public-private cooperation, the key to success

The first stage of the operation involved a thorough triage effort. Iris Global worked closely with the Spanish emergency services, specifically with the Spanish Maritime Rescue Society, in order to coordinate the patient’s evacuation. Ensuring that the amputated limb was kept in optimum conditions for its reattachment was a priority, so speed and effectiveness were crucial to the evacuation. This first step underlines the importance of smooth communication and cooperation between government bodies and private organisations at times of crisis.

Once the transfer to the hospital was secured, the next challenge was to find an experienced surgeon who was qualified to perform the surgical reattachment. Here is where fortune smiled on the coordination team: a highly renowned Spanish plastic surgeon, known for his leadership in innovative surgical procedures across the globe, was available and at a nearby location. This coincidence not only made the process easier, but also increased the surgery’s chance of success.

Lastly, thanks to the quick intervention, the effective coordination, and the medical expertise available, the surgical reattachment was successful. The patient was able to recover their hand thanks to the plastic surgeon’s dexterity and to the joint efforts of everyone involved in the operation. This case emphasises the importance of having a sound international assistance network and expert coordination team in emergencies, and it shows that interdisciplinary collaboration and rapid response can make the difference.
